many-a-one
phrase
/ˈmɛni ə wʌn/

Definition
A phrase used to refer to a situation or a person among many individuals or instances.

Examples
- Many-a-one has struggled with the same issue over the years.
- In many-a-one’s opinion, teamwork is essential for success.

Meaning
This expression indicates that something applies to numerous individuals or situations, often used to emphasize the variety or distinction among a group.

Synonyms
- each of many
- numerous individuals
- various ones
